  • I have never ran with my dog, can I enter?

    Dogs love to run, but just like humans, dogs need to work up to a running distance. Please take your dog's training seriously.


    We ask that only dogs aged 1 and above participate in the 10k and 5k events.


    If you are unsure whether your dog is fit enough, please consult your vet.

  • What are the rules for participating?

    The emphasis of our events is to have fun with your dog in the great outdoors. However, to make this an enjoyable event for all, please follow the below guidelines:

    • If your dog is reactive, please ensure your dog is wearing a muzzle. This must be baskerville style, allowing the dog to pant and drink.
    • Please refrain from attending if your dog has recently developed a cough.
    • Please be respectful to other participants, don't allow your dog to lunge at others - some dogs can be anxious.
    • When passing others on the course, choose a time when you have plenty space and make them aware you're going to be passing.

  • Do I need any specialist equipment to enter?

    Every dog is different and every running style is different.


    If you are running in the canicross wave, you must be wearing the correct canicross equipment. For those not running in the canicross wave but still running with your dog, we would advise at least wearing a well fitting y-front harness.


    The walking wave requires no specialist equipment.


    Find out more about equipment and a special offer on our EQUIPMENT page.


    Choke chains, slip leads and restrictive harnesses will not be permitted.
